Witam Mam następujące pytanie: "Metody realizacji cyfrowej funkcji sinus" Do głowy przychodzą mi następujące pomysły: - tabelaryzacja sinusa za okres i przechowywanie go w pamięci (look-up tables) - aproksymacji wielomianem przy użyciu rozwinięcia w szereg Taylora lub McLarena Czy istnieją jakieś inne znane wam metody? Dodano po 55 OK. Sam sobie odpowiem...
rozumiem, że masz uzasadniony pogląd, że sinus będzie najlepszym modelem, zjawisko jest okresowe? A o ile okresowe, masz wiele okresów pokryć, czy tylko maksymalnie ładnie odrysować 1-3 okresy? Nieokresowe da się (chyba) ugryźć Fourierem, ale wiele składowych będzie ... Bo ze słabej już pamięci są aproksymacja wielomianem (zakładanego stopnia), najmniejszych...
Witam, tak jak już wspomniał soothsayer możesz wykonać pomiary, ale zamiast aproksymacji wielomianem możesz wykorzystać tablicę wartości (tzw. lookup table), oczywiście rozdzielczość zależy wtedy od wielkości tablicy.
Pomiar w dwóch punktach jest dobry jeśli chcesz mierzyć w pobliżu tych punktów, prosta wg której będzie można obliczyć wynik da błąd zerowy w miejscach pomiaru ale co poza nimi? błąd pomiaru może być znaczny, niestety nie jest to sposób optymalny wyznaczenia prostej - lepszym sposobem jest tu aproksymacja np metoda najmniejszych kwadratów. Tez możesz...
wielkie dzięki! :P :P :P
Poszukaj sobie w literaturze o metodzie najmniejszych kwadratów.
Może postawi mnie to w złym świetle ale nie mam pojęcia jak przeprowadzić aproksymacje wielomianem w exelu. Mogę prosić o jakieś wskazówki?
Tak, na szereg różnych sposobów. Można przez UART zmieniać program sterujący (z użyciem bootloadera), można też zawrzeć w programie sterującym parser wyrażeń, które będą realizowane przez program po odebraniu ich przez UART. Pytanie jest jednak zadane w sposób zbyt ogólny by na nie odpowiedzieć. Po pierwsze podany przykład to nie algorytm lecz wyrażenie,...
dzięki, muszę sprawdzić jak to działa. Obecnie znalazłem aproksymację wielomianem ale dla 2 stopnia wielomianu i dużej ilości punktów max funkcji jest bardzo mało widoczne i bardzo wygładzone (za bardzo). Do moich potrzeb jednak nie jest wskazane aby funkcja miała punkty przegięcia. Dla poszukujących dokładam opis na m punktów i wielomianu n stopnia...
Tablicę warto stosować w przypadku gdy sygnał pomiarowy reprezentuje funkcja, która zawiera punkt przegięcia. Dla funkcji wypukłej (wklęsłej) łatwiej będzie zastosować aproksymację wielomianem. Jak znajdę chwilę czasu to policzę to dla Twojego czujnika i podrzucę na forum. Być może uda się to zrobić w ograniczonym przedziale jaki podałeś. http://obrazki.elektroda.pl/4094572000_1...
witam, robie aproksymacje różnych funkcji z wykorzystaniem standardowych funkcji Matlaba. Chodzi mi jedynie o to, na jakiej podstawie dobierać wielkość rzędu n wielomianu potęgowego stopień), który potem jest używany przy wyznaczaniu aproksymacji. Czy istnieją jakies kryteria? pozdr.
Nie rozumiesz. Nie możesz robić dwa razy aproksymacji. Z resztą po co.? Mnożysz przez stałe(promień przełożenie itd) CAŁY wielomian otrzymany z aproksymacji danych z OBD. Ten wielomian różniczkujesz RĘCZNIE i mnożysz przez masę. Rugujesz czas i masz moment od RPM. Trzba jeszcze uzgodnić jednostki, czyli wrócić do RPM z obrotów na sekundę. Nie musisz...
Da się to jakoś uzyskać? Da się, np. stosując aproksymację z użyciem szeregów Fouriera albo Taylora. Innymi słowy trzeba znaleźć taki wielomian, który jest podobny do tego fioletowego przebiegu. Z tego co widzę masz standardowy oscyloskop, gdzie funkcje MATH mogą przyjmować tylko sygnał z kanałów A i B. Gdyby dało się zrobić MATH(MATH(A,B)) to miałbyś...
Moja własna konstrukcja nie jest jeszcze gotowa do zaprezentowania, ale bdb sprawdza się regulacja obciążenia od obrotów generatora, a zmiana obciążenia od skoku (gradientu) zmian obrotów. Też dobry sposób. Jeśli masz już informacje o obrotach to błąd regulacji będzie najmniejszy. Ja przyjąłem w swoim algorytmie napięcie na wyjściu jako parametr wejściowy,...
Mam do narysowania wykres z Turbo Delphi i niestety nie mam tam do dyspozycji TChart :( i muszę stosować PaintBox'a jednak mam problem ze skalowaniem wykresu. Dokładniej chodzi o to, że mam 5 punktów z których po aproksymacji dostaję równanie wielomianu. Ten wlaśnie wielomian mam wykreślić w granicach X od min do max wynikającego z punktów wprowadzonych...
Akurat nie ma to nic wspólnego z elektrodą. Elektrody profesjonalne z firmy Hydromet, modele ERH-AQ1 oraz ERH-13-6. Nowe, mają pełen poziom elektrolitu i moczyłem je najpierw 12h w buforze o pH7. Tzn. niestabilny jest pomiar napięcia na ADC, bo na multimetrze jest w miarę stabilny. Co do wielomianu ? Jakaś wskazówka więcej ? Jaki to jest stopień wielomianu,...
Może to pomoże: http://aproks.republika.pl/ Aproksymować można za pomocą różnych funkcji - musisz napisać czy chcesz to przybliżać funkcją liniową, wielomianem czy jakąś inną. PS.Aproksymacja to nie uśrednianie - jak to ktoś wczesniej napisał...
Wielomian interpolacyjny 2 stopnia można wyznaczyć mając minimum 3 punkty i stosując np. algorytm Lagrange'a (pierwsza strona google, łatwe do implementacji w Matlabie). Jeżeli wystarczy ci aproksymacja (czyli przejście funkcji najbliżej wszystkich punktów danych w sensie minimum kwadratu odległości) to jest funkcja polyfit [np. [a,ss]=polyfit(x,y,2)...
Z tymi charakterystykami potencjometrów jest namieszane - chińczycy inaczej oznaczali je, dlatego mogą być A logarytmiczne itp. A jeśli chodzi o aproksymację to zrób pomiary, narysuj przebieg zmierzona wartość jako funkcja max prądu. Wtedy spojrzysz na to co wyjdzie, i zobaczysz czy rozjezdza ci się liniowo, czy troche jest zagięcie. Są też w necie...
Podziel Y przez 1000 a wynik przemnóż. Widać ewidentnie, że dla twojego zestawu danych współczynniki są mniejsze niż przyjęta przez ciebie dokładność wyświetlania / zaokrąglenia. Weź też poprawkę na obecność fpu w twoim uc. PS. apropo postów wyżej o tablicy itd. Nie musisz wpisywać całości, wystarczy aproksymacja odcinkowo liniowa dla przedziałów spełniających...
Z tym szukaniem to miałem na myśli to że akurat w trakcie pisania posta się za to zabierałem. Wartości funkcji T(x) to żadna tajemnica - to po prostu wyniki pomiaru tłumienności światłowodów (stosowanych jako czujniki mikrozgięciowe czyli inaczej amplitudowych czujników światłowodowych). Dopiero teraz miałem czas żeby zasiąść przed komputerem, dziękuję...
ChatGPT już skutecznie zastępuje pomocnika-juniora Ciekawe, że modele językowe potrafią używać narzędzi, ale potrafią to taż naczelne, niektóre ptaki... Ale to nadal wygląda jakby chcieć do pomocy zawołać średnio ogarniętego ucznia z podstawówki. Czego nie umie, to wygoogla. Jedyna korzyść, że odpowiedź jest szybciej. Liczenie prostej przechodzącej...
Kolejny weekend oraz kolejna symulacja. Na warsztat wziąłem algorytm PSF, czyli dopasowania obciążenia wg krzywej mocy. To na zasadzie jak na poniższym rys. https://obrazki.elektroda.pl/5356873700_... Na podstawie punktów: początkowego 'A' oraz nominalnego 'B' wyliczam współczynniki wielomianu, a potem na jego podstawie obliczam jaką...
Witaj! Z czujnikiem (NTC = 10k), który ja stosowałem poradziłem sobie w następujący sposób. Włączyłem go szeregowo z rezystorem 10k pomiędzy wyjście napięcia referencyjnego i masę analogową mikrokontrolera. Przetwornikiem A/DC mierzyłem bezpośrednio wartość napięcia na termistorze. Ze względu na znaczną nieliniowość takiego układu pomiarowego nie zdecydowałem...
Mam taki problem. Otóż mam tabelę z wartościami - zysk anteny w zależności od częstotliwości (w sumie chyba nie istotne co to za dane). Problem jest taki, że zyski są podane dla częstotliwości z zakresu 250MHz do 900MHz co 10MHz. Ja potrzebuję większej dokładności, miejscami dochodzącej do 0.25MHz. Więc generalnie zwiększenie dokładności do tych 0.25MHz...
Dlatego proponuje zostać przy stablicowaniu wyników pomiaru i aproksymacji odcinkowo liniowej ;) Oba sposoby są dobre i wykonalne. Ale bardziej eleganckim wydaje sie wielomian (uproszczony do 3-ciej potęgi). BTW. W bascomie raczej sie nie potęguje tylko wielokrotnie mnoży. Jeśli te operacje przeprowadzić na liczbach całkowitych to nie zajmują dużo...
nie wydaje mi sie zeby jakos te czujniki sie skalowalo... Nie chodzi o skalowanie tylko o kalibrację. Każdy czujnik można kalibrować programowo. Możesz poprostu umieścić czujnik w odległości 4cm i zmierzyć napięcie, następnie umieścić go w odległości 6cm i zmierzyć napięcie następnie w odległości 8cm i tak dalej. Uzyskaną w ten sposób charakterystykę...
Losowe elementy wektora Ai były tylko próbą funkcji LOS. Teraz mają wartości stałe bo przypuszczam, że przy wartościach losowych nawet Solver zgłupiałby jak za każdym krokiem pracy Solvera w wektorze Ai były inne wartości (nie próbowałem tego - szkoda czasu). Jak wcześniej pisałem wczytywanie adresu każdej komórki do funkcji SUMA jest żmudne. Wprawdzie...
Witam Mam za zadanie zaprojektować regulator typu Dead Beat dla obiektu o transmitancji: G(s)=\frac{s+0.03}{10s^3+4.5s^2+1.85s+0.... . W tym celu stosując aproksymację trapezami wyznaczyłem dyskretną postać transmitancji: G(z)=\frac{2.03z^3 +2.09z^2 -1.91z -1.97}{101.95z^3 -253.85z^2 +218.75z -65.55}=\frac{L(z)}{M(z)} . Następnie wyznaczam transmitancję...
Witam, Jesli mozesz uzyc VHDL to polecam (i uzywam) biblioteke do operacji stalo przecinkowej fixed_pkg. Na stronie rowniez znajduje sie package z operacjami zmiennoprzecinkowej float_pkg(sprawdzalem mnozenie i dodawanie - dziala). Bardzo latwo sie tego uzywa, dziala, duzo mozliwosci parametryzji (szerokosz danych, dokladnosc obliczen). Biblioteka weszla...
Oj, a ja myślałem, że ręcznie rysujesz... Choć i punkty Krzywej Beziera także można aproksymować dość łatwo... Jeśli zależy wyłącznie na wyglądzie a nie na wartościach aproksymowanych, to wydaje mi się, że Krzywe Beziera są dość szybkie i efektywne. W zasadzie kierunek wektorów (każda krzywa opisana jest punktem początkowym, końcowym i przypisanymi...
Zadaniem robota jest jedynie omijanie przeszkody. Można założyć, że jest to ruch raczej chaotyczny... Nie, sieć została nauczona w Matlabie i nie ulega zmianom na robocie. Zabawka jest cool, ale robot to raczej nie jest :D Na egzaminie z góry przygotowałbym odpowiedź na pytanie czy układ jest stabilny i w jakim sensie, to taka drobna rada, oraz gdzie...
Generalnie chodzi koledze o pokazanie "właściwej" wartości sygnału pomiędzy próbkami? Generalnie tak - szukam skutecznej metody. Znam te z dokumentu - problemem jest że w miarę dokładne odwzorowanie krzywej w przypadku sygnałów o dużym spektrum (np sygnału prostokątnego) wymaga zbyt dużo mocy obliczeniowe do liczenia tego w locie (ładnie wyglądają...
Wprawdzie nie znam języka Python, ale widać wyraźnie, że ten skrypt raczej tylko narysuje wykres. W celu wyznaczenia współczynników a i b musiałbyś rozwiązać nieliniowy układ równań. Dla takich układów nadal liczba równań musi być równa liczbie niewiadomych. Podstaw zatem skrajne wartości X i Y do wzoru po czym wyznacz współczynniki metodą Newtona....
Ja chcę wyciągnąć z takiego sygnału tylko informację CO słychać w sygnale (czy to samochód, czy pociąg, czy samolot, czy jeszcze coś innego), nie interesuje mnei informacja kiedy on się pojawił. Zgodnie jednak z tym co piszesz "zokienkowanie" sygnału ułątwi wyciąganie tych charakterystycznych dla każdego cech, czy tak? Tak, powinno to ułatwić wyłuskanie...
(at)ElektrodaBot - jakich opcji gcc trzeba użyć dla procesora X86 o architekturze Haswell, aby wygenerował instrukcje zmiennoprzecinkowe w kodzie, zamiast wywoływać funkcje biblioteczne? Próbowałem "gcc -march=haswell -mfpmath=both -mhard-float -O9" - bez powodzenia, wywołuje np. "cos(at)PLT", nie używa wprost FCOS. Bezpośrednia odpowiedź - Nie wymusisz...
Witam Zastanawiam się w jaki sposób określasz tu samą temperaturę. Nie zastosowałeś tu żadnej aproksymacji wielomianowej a zwykłe mnożenie, o ile dobrze widzę to ten fragment: //dana *= 42530;//180k dana *= 31940;//240k dana >>= 16; dana += 25; Współczynniki dla termopary K są ogólnie dostępne. Dodano po 2 Gratuluję przemyślanej konstrukcji. Zerknąłem...
http://obrazki.elektroda.pl/6007624100_1... Od czasu opisu ponizej mocno się zmieniło :) Staram się pisać kolejne posty na dole :) Stał sie dość złożony - tak że porządna instrukcja obsługi by się przydała :) http://obrazki.elektroda.pl/1225555800_1... http://obrazki.elektroda.pl/9096174000_1... To taki...
witam musze napisac pewnie programik a w zasadzie znalazłem taki o jaki mi chodzi z tym ze napisany w pascalu i musze go zamienic na c. Napisał bym sam program ale niestety nie rozumiem aproksymacji i wiele godzin nauki i czytania o niej nie przyniosły rezultatu. Teraz moje pytanie czy jesli przepisze wszystko jak leci na c to bedzie działac? wydaje...
Dla funkcji: f1 = 2*exp(-x)*sin(2x) f2 = |x-1|+1 a) wyznaczyć ich wartości w N (dla N od 4 do 20) równo odległych punktach z przedziału -4 < x < 6. Wyznaczyć współczynniki wielomianów N-1 stopnia interpolujących tak wyznaczone dane. Wykreślić wartości funkcji i wielomianów interpolujących te funkcje w podanym przedziale (zaznaczyć węzły interpolacji)....
Witam muszę zrealizować projekt który zakłada wyznaczenie błędu nieliniowości charakterstyki przetwarzania w odniesieniu do prostej, która przechodzi przez punkty współrzędnych wyznaczonych przez zakres przetwarzania, oraz za pomocą metody najmniejszych kwadratów, a także stosując metodę aproksymacji średniokwadratowej wielomianowej zbadać wpływ stopnia...
witam mam do napisania 2 projekty szukam chetnego. kontakt na forum lub maila ziomgub(małpa)o2.pl lub gg4846990 Podaje tematy : Temat: Bierny filtr RC 1. Założenia: 1.1. filtr górnoprzepustowy, 1.2. częstotliwość graniczna fd = 50 Hz 1.3. zastosować elementy RC zgodne z ciągiem E12, tzn. ±10%, znamionowych rezystancji i pojemności. 2. Zadania...
aproksymacja sinusoida aproksymacja schodkowa aproksymacja funkcja
dobór tranzystor mosfet skoda fabia kontrolka drzwi schemat piły tarczowej
schemat kiedy świeci żarówka schemat kiedy świeci żarówka
Zabezpieczenie wzmacniacza WS432: przekaźnik i tranzystory BC237, BC211 Cewki w piecykach Junkers: ile i jakie?